Abstract

The study aimed to explore how the role-playing approach can foster the social-emotional skills of children aged 4 and 5 years at Perwanida 1 Mrican Kindergarten, Kediri City. This study used a quasi-experimental design with a pretest-posttest control group model and quantitative methodology. Thirty-five children participated, and they were divided into two groups: the experimental group and the control group. Based on early childhood social-emotional development markers, data were collected through observation. Data analysis included homogeneity, normality, and sample t-tests. The findings showed that the experimental group's average pretest score of 37.58 significantly increased to 88.07 in the posttest. However, the control group's score only slightly increased from 38.73 to 40.90. A substantial difference between the two groups was demonstrated by the hypothesis test findings, which showed a significance score <0.001. Therefore, it can be said that the role-playing approach significantly improves the social-emotional skills of children aged 4 to 5 years. This approach has been shown to be successful in increasing children's self-confidence and prosocial behavior, as well as collaboration skills, emotional control, and adherence to rules.
